Can you write final Matric exams without ID?

An ID is a document that helps establish a person’s unique identity. It serves as proof of their citizenship, residency, and personal information. 

The identification system is designed to make everyday tasks easier. 

Having a valid ID is just as important when it comes to final matric exams. In order to accurately identify students and prevent cheating, educational institutions typically require students to present their IDs. 

Having an ID is important because it allows us to confirm that the student is eligible to take the exam. It also helps us ensure the correct person receives the right results. 

Also, it helps to ensure that the examination process remains reliable and fair, thus safeguarding the credibility and integrity of the educational system.

Reports indicate that if a matric learner cannot present a birth certificate, they can provide alternative forms of identification, such as an affidavit or a sworn statement from their parent, caregiver, or guardian. Frazer states that learners must submit their IDs within six months of taking the exams.

If you have lost your ID or have no ID at all, it can be difficult to sit for your final matric exams. The ID confirms the individual prior to entering the exam hall.

However, candidates who may not have their ID to write the final matric exams can provide any document proving their identity. This could be a sworn affidavit by the guardian or parents. Once there is a document that confirms and certifies your identity, you can be allowed to write the final matric exams.

How much do Matric finals count?

Although the final matric exams play a vital role in the overall assessment, however, it does constitute 100% of the exams. During your study period, test and other projects are considered to be part of your final matric exam score.

All tests and assessments done are counted in percentage. These are calculated and added up after your final matric exams. The final matric exam is calculated to have 75% of the final grading score of your matric examination. If you are looking to know how much the matric final counts for, then have it in mind that it has been pegged at 75% of your final grading. 

How can I change my matric certificate ID?

 Your matric certificate ID is considered to be the main details of your identity, which could be your name, ID number, and examination number. These details form part of your matric certificate to make it valid and certified. 

Should there be any cases where you wish to change your matric certificate ID, remember you can not alter the ID number used in the matric registration unless there is a reason beyond doubt. 

In the case where you have changed your name and believe your new name should reflect on your matric certificate, it is important to have a supporting document like an affidavit to back the claims.

In all cases, individuals who wish to change their matric certificate ID can submit a letter of request to the Department of Education indicating the need to change their matric certificate ID. This letter must be accompanied by other supporting documents to actually confirm your claims. If you have reason to amend the ID on your matric certificate, the Department of basic education is the right place to review and finalize that.
